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0724394 19444 47658038418
88544182392 41103476
88544182392 41103476
3289621749 729651236 58
All about undefined
Interested in learning more?
88544182392 41103476
3289621749 729651236 58
See more
769186428 67
0089472580 61870 39169557 7533922460
See more
679083160 0432833555
2288 19266584 508815
See more